Texas A&M University · Nuclear Engineering
Carlo Fiorina is an Associate Professor in the Department of Nuclear Engineering at Texas A&M University. He holds a Ph.D. in Energy and Nuclear Science and Technology, a Master's in Nuclear Engineering, and a Bachelor's in Electrical Engineering, all from Politecnico di Milano, Italy.
